Beko Motor Overheat / Thermistor Fault

Washer displays H3; often related to motor overheating or motor thermistor fault on some Beko models.

Possible Causes

Blocked motor cooling, Overloaded drum, Faulty motor thermal protector, PCB misreading motor temperature

How to Fix / Troubleshooting

Safety first: Unplug the washer and allow it to cool for at least 30 minutes.

Step-by-step checks:

  • Reduce load: Remove some laundry and run a shorter cycle.
  • Inspect motor area: Remove rear panel and ensure motor vents are not clogged with lint or dust.

If H3 recurs frequently under normal loads, the motor or PCB temperature sensing circuit may be faulty and should be checked by a technician.
